Yes, you can't re-equip the item, because it thinks you don't have enough stats.

But it's only visual, at least in my case. Sometimes I had to reload 2-3 times to make it work, other times it was perfectly fine until I reloaded.

Basically your items above 5 of the required stats will show as greyed out, but in fact they're still equipped. For example, if you have a warrior that gets this bug, you'll see as if you were attacking an opponent with your fists, but you're doing full damage of your weapon - with all your stats.
It also messes up your skillbar and Action Points bar too, so it'll appear you can still attack with 2 AP left, while wearing a 2-hander (and you'll hit them with your fists, but in reality on the host's screen you're not doing anything, unless you have at least 4 AP).

I assume it has something to do with the invited person, haven't seen it happen on host yet. Did you try trading save files and change host? Might solve it.

So my guess is, it has something to do with character being corrupted on the client side, while on host's side it's perfectly fine. Also whenever the host took over my "bugged" character, he saw everything is as it should be.

It is a really good game but let me propose some features that could make it excellent.

1. Scrolling the list of locations in the teleport menu is too slow and boring. Why not place location names in several columns?
2. Sometimes it is not a trivial problem to aim the cursor on a target. It would be convenient if one could pick a target by clicking on an icon in the queue in the top of the window. I was slightly wondered when I realized that I can't pick a target in that way. And developers could permit the camera to rotate on 360 degrees. Seriously, it would greatly facilitate aiming.
3. There is one more thing that complicate aiming. Target is moving when one is trying to aim. I mean animation of various body movements. You aim, target stirs, you click, and... your character does not the action it supposed to do because you clicked on the ground. It is really annoying thing. I am confident that there is some way to fix it.
4. What do you think about necessity of repairing weapon? Am I the only one who consider it superfluous?

You can use the top row of icons during combat to target opponents with spells/skills.

In the Game section of the options you can unlock 360 degree rotation.

During combat you can aim for the feet (most of the idle animation movement is in the upper body), or switch to the overhead tactical view (hotkey b).
